RHOC's Alexis Bellino Threatens to Expose Videos of Shannon Beador From Night of DUI
View
Date:2025-04-17 06:58:13
The feud between Alexis Bellino and Shannon Beador is heating up hotter than the SoCal sun.
During The Real Housewives of Orange County's Aug. 15 episode, Bellino declared she was officially done with her costar bad-mouthing her ex John Janssen, who Bellino is now dating.
"If she wasn't still going around making up lies about him, I wouldn't be on a hell path," she told costars Tamra Judge, Jennifer Pedranti and Katie Ginella during a group trip to Big Bear, Calif. "He has not a bad bone in his body. I'm so over him being abused. I'm so over him being lied about."
In a confessional, Bellino explained that the businessman isn't the bad guy Beador has painted him to be following their 2022 breakup.
"I get really worked up about John, because the man is nothing but kind, generous, loving and caring," the 47-year-old defended him. "And, unfortunately, Shannon has ruined John's reputation throughout the community. If the girls actually gave John a chance, they would see the man that I see."
Plus, he was Bellino's only support during one of the darkest times of her life.
"My mom recently passed away," the Bravo star tearfully added, "and John has been the only one that has been by my side."
But when Bellino's costars urged her to end the drama and move on, she dropped a bombshell.
"Do I need to pull out the videos?" she asked the group. "Johnny's ready to talk. So, yeah, I will stop her."
And when Bellino added that her alleged receipts "will ruin her life," Judge clarified, "She has videos of her the night of her DUI."
In a confessional, Bellino confirmed she's holding on to footage taken of Beador the night she was arrested in September 2023 after crashing her car into a house in Newport Beach, Calif. following a fight with Janssen.
"The videos are definitely horrific," Bellino claimed. "Once I saw them, I couldn't go back to feeling the same about her."
Bellino further told the women, "She has now pushed us to the point where, if she doesn't stop lying," before Judge finished her sentence with, "He'll expose it."
Plus, Bellino warned, "It's 10 times worse than you can actually imagine."
